/*******************************
* print usage
*******************************/
void usage(void)
{
fprintf (stderr, "Usage: %s [OPTION] [COMMAND]...\n", MYNAME);
fprintf (stderr, "Send commands to fvwm via %sS\n\n", MYNAME);
fprintf (stderr,
" -c read and send commands from stdin\n"
" The COMMAND if any is ignored.\n");
fprintf (stderr,
" -S <file name> "
"invoke another %s server with fifo <file name>\n",
MYNAME);
fprintf (stderr,
" -f <file name> use fifo <file name> to connect to %sS\n",
MYNAME);
fprintf (stderr,
" -i <info level> 0 - error only\n" );
fprintf (stderr,
" 1 - above and config info (default)\n" );
fprintf (stderr,
" 2 - above and static info\n" );
fprintf (stderr,
" 3 - above and dynamic info\n" );
fprintf (stderr,
" -1 - none (default, much faster)\n" );
fprintf (stderr,
" -F <flag info> 0 - no flag info\n");
fprintf (stderr,
" 2 - full flag info (default)\n");
fprintf (stderr,
" -m monitor fvwm message transaction\n");
fprintf (stderr,
" -r "
"wait for a reply (overrides waiting time)\n");
fprintf (stderr,
" -v print version number\n");
fprintf (stderr,
" -w <micro sec> waiting time for the reponse from fvwm\n");
fprintf (stderr, "\nDefault fifo names are ~/.%sC and ~/.%sM\n",
MYNAME, MYNAME);
fprintf (stderr, "Default waiting time is 500,000 us\n");
}
